Namibia’s Dunes: A Journey Through the World’s Tallest Sand Mountains

Namibia is home to some of the most breathtaking landscapes on the planet, particularly its iconic sand dunes, which are renowned for their towering heights and striking colors. Among these, the Sossusvlei region stands out as a must-visit destination for those seeking to experience the majesty of the world’s tallest sand mountains. The dunes here, some reaching heights of over 300 meters, are formed from fine grains of quartz that have been shaped by the relentless winds of the Namib Desert. As the sun rises and sets, the dunes transform, casting shadows and creating a mesmerizing palette of reds, oranges, and browns that captivate photographers and nature enthusiasts alike.

One of the most famous dunes in Sossusvlei is Dune 45, which is easily accessible and offers a relatively gentle climb to its summit. Visitors often rise before dawn to witness the sunrise from the top, where the panoramic views of the surrounding landscape are nothing short of spectacular. The experience of standing atop Dune 45 as the first rays of sunlight illuminate the desert is a moment that lingers in the memory long after the journey has ended. The contrast between the vibrant colors of the dunes and the deep blue sky creates a visual feast that is unique to this part of the world.

As one ventures deeper into the Sossusvlei area, the surreal landscape continues to unfold. Deadvlei, a white clay pan surrounded by towering orange dunes, is another highlight of the region. The stark contrast between the dead camel thorn trees, which have stood for centuries, and the bright white pan creates an otherworldly atmosphere. This area is not only a photographer’s paradise but also a site of ecological interest, as it showcases the resilience of life in one of the harshest environments on Earth. The ancient trees, some estimated to be over 900 years old, tell a story of survival against the odds, having adapted to the extreme conditions of the desert.

In addition to Sossusvlei, the Namib-Naukluft National Park encompasses a vast expanse of desert that is rich in biodiversity. The park is home to a variety of wildlife, including oryx, springbok, and even the elusive desert-adapted elephants. Exploring this national park provides an opportunity to witness the delicate balance of life in such an arid environment. The stark beauty of the landscape, combined with the chance to encounter wildlife in their natural habitat, makes for an unforgettable adventure.

What are the best times to visit Namibia for desert escapes?

The best times to visit Namibia for desert escapes are during the dry season, from May to October. This period offers cooler temperatures and clear skies, ideal for exploring the vast landscapes.

What activities can I enjoy in the Namib Desert?

Visitors to the Namib Desert can enjoy activities such as dune climbing, hot air ballooning, and wildlife viewing. Photography enthusiasts will also find endless opportunities to capture stunning desert vistas.

Are there guided tours available for exploring the Namib Desert?

Yes, there are numerous guided tours available that cater to different interests and budgets. These tours often include transportation, meals, and knowledgeable guides to enhance the experience.

What should I pack for a trip to the Namib Desert?

It is essential to pack lightweight, breathable clothing, a wide-brimmed hat, sunscreen, and plenty of water. Sturdy hiking boots and a camera for capturing the breathtaking scenery are also recommended.

Is it safe to travel in the Namib Desert?

Traveling in the Namib Desert is generally safe, but it is important to take precautions such as staying hydrated and following local guidelines. It is advisable to travel with a guide or as part of an organized tour for added safety.
